TRS-Care: Be Ready Before You Need It

The Pulse
August 2026

One of the best parts of retirement is having more time and freedom to focus on the things you love — travel, grandkids hobbies you never had time for before. The last thing you want is to lose time hunting for a phone number, wondering where to go for care or trying to decipher what your health plan actually covers, all while you're not feeling well.

Taking a few simple steps today can help you feel confident and prepared, no matter what comes your way. Here's where to start. 

  • Know Where to Turn for Care

    Not every health concern calls for the same kind of care, and knowing your options ahead of time can help you avoid unnecessary costs and get seen faster.

    • In-network providers — Search by location and specialty with Provider Finder® if you're on TRS-Care Standard, or Find a Provider if you're on TRS-Care Medicare Advantage.
    • Urgent care locations — for things that need attention soon but aren't emergencies.
    • Virtual care options — TRS-Care Standard participants have access to TRS Virtual Health through Teladoc® and RediMD for non-emergency visits from home. TRS-Care Medicare Advantage participants can use HouseCalls and virtual visits through UnitedHealthcare — ask your Customer Service team what's available on your plan. 

    Knowing where to start before a health need comes up can make the moment it actually happens a lot less stressful. 

  • Keep Important Information Handy

    When a question about your coverage comes up, having the right information within reach saves you time and frustration. Consider keeping these on hand — in your wallet, on your fridge or saved in your phone: 

    • Customer service contact information for your plan (see the numbers below)
    • Your health plan member ID card — for TRS-Care Medicare Advantage, that's your UCard, which also unlocks over-the-counter (OTC) purchases, rewards and more
    • Personal Health Guide contact information, if you're on TRS-Care Standard
    • Important health plan websites bookmarked on your computer or phone:

  • Check Your MyTRS Account

    If you haven't logged in recently, now's a good time. A few minutes today can help make sure your personal information is current and put important benefit details at your fingertips later, when you actually need them.

    • Log in (or register) at the MyTRS Member Portal — health plan information lives under the "Health Coverage" tile.
    • Confirm your address, dependents and beneficiary information are up to date, especially after any life changes.
    • Bookmark it now, so you're not searching for the login page later. 
  • Take Advantage of Resources Included in Your Plan

    Many retirees are surprised to learn about everything included with their plan — often not until they needed it. A few minutes exploring now can help you get more value out of your benefits all year. Here are just a few that you may not know about. 

    If you're on TRS-Care Standard:
    • The Fitness Program — affordable, no-contract gym memberships nationwide, from digital-only access starting at about $10 a month up to full-network access, along with discounts on acupuncture, massage and personal training. Explore it under Health and Wellbeing.
    • Well onTarget® wellness coaching — free, one-on-one coaching from dietitians, nurses and other credentialed experts to help you set and reach personal health goals. Learn more.
    • Mental health support — including Headway for finding an in-network therapist and Learn to Live for self-guided programs on stress, anxiety and depression.
    • Member Rewards — earn money back for services such as a mammogram, colonoscopy or an annual wellness visit. Details are under Member Rewards.
    • Personal Health Guides — call 1-866-355-5999 with a question or to help you decide where to go for care.
    If you're on TRS-Care Medicare Advantage:
    • Renew Active® — a fitness program included at no extra cost, with access to a nationwide gym network (including all Life Time locations), on-demand workout videos and a brain-health program. Access it through your UCard or the UnitedHealthcare app.
    • Rewards through your UCard — earn funds for completing preventive activities such as your annual wellness visit, and redeem them at participating retailers. A quarterly $40 over-the-counter (OTC) credit ($160 a year) is also loaded onto your UCard for covered over-the-counter items.
    • HouseCalls — an in-home preventive visit, plus virtual video visit options if you'd rather not leave home. 
    • Explore more at Coverage and Benefits or the Resources page

Enjoy the Confidence of Being Prepared

Health care needs don't come with advance notice, but a little preparation can help you navigate them with far more confidence. By knowing where to find information, who to call and what resources are already part of your plan, you'll be ready for whatever comes up — and free to focus on what matters most: Enjoying your retirement.
